The Communications Authority of Kenya is the regulatory authority for the communications sector in Kenya. Established in 1999 by the Kenya Information and Communications Act, 1998, the Authority is responsible for facilitating the development of the Information and Communications sectors including; broadcasting, multimedia, telecommunications, electronic commerce, postal and courier services.

Duties and responsibilities at this level will entail:

  • Providing leadership and overseeing the day-to-day management of postal/courier licensing, e-commerce, and National Addressing System (NAS) including postcode affairs
  • Managing the function of postal/courier License development
  • Directing the development of new Licences by providing technical input with regard to the market structures
  • Providing support in dispute resolution with regard to the interpretation of Licence conditions, management of addressing, e-commerce, and postcode operations
  • Maintaining Licensee registers and ensuring its integrity
  • Developing, validating, and implementing a roadmap for NAS activities
  • Developing, validating, and implementing a roadmap for e-commerce activities
  • In liaison with county addressing units to manage the national addressing database at the national level
  • Working with the County Addressing Units (CAUs) counties and Address Implementation Teams (AITs) at the sub-county level to locate and name roads in accordance with national standards and guidelines
  • Oversee compilation and maintenance of an electronic database of property addresses in the country at the national level from counties
  • Ensure the National Communications Addressing And Numbering Plan (NCANP) is updated from time to time with addresses and postcodes as may be necessary
  • Instituting fines for continued non-compliance in addressing e-commerce activities
  • Identifying specific national interests, developing national positions, and championing the same at international fora, treaty, and non-treaty conferences
